Network «9-1-1»: a pharmacy giant or a factory for booking evaders?
Network «9-1-1» effectively captured the Ukrainian pharmacy market. Under a familiar sign operate 1813 pharmacies in 23 regions, but legally this is 101 a separate company, united by common beneficiaries — Nune and Anush Danilyan. Most have the same registration address — Kharkiv, Bilostocki drive, 3, common directors, a single trading infrastructure and centralized management. Formally — dozens of different enterprises, in fact — one business empire divided into separate legal entities.
Through the Representation of «Skill Trade SP. z o.o.» in just two years they cycled over 2,04 billion UAH under the guise of royalties for patents and software. At the same time over 2 billion UAH were not recorded as income, and the calculated amount of unpaid corporate income tax exceeds 361 million UAH. After that, funds were distributed among the 101 related company, of which at least 26 are already implicated in criminal proceedings. Separately through «Transform-Kharkiv», which officially handles transportation, fictitious employment was arranged to obtain bookings, and the staff of the company since 2023 year increased by more than a thousand.
Questions also arose from the Antimonopoly Committee of Ukraine. After February 2025 year, pharmacies «9-1-1» sharply reduced sales of medicines from certain Ukrainian manufacturers without objective market reasons. At the same time the network had been operating for years under the banner «Wholesale Price Pharmacy», though customers did not receive confirmation that medicines were sold at wholesale prices. Because of this AMCU is investigating possible signs of unfair competition and misleading consumers.
If tax claims harm the budget, then violations of drug storage conditions directly concern people’s health. In the network there was no proper temperature control: no continuous monitoring, no full tracking of temperature indicators, no mechanisms to respond to deviations, and documentation did not allow confirming compliance with manufacturers' requirements. As a result, it is impossible to determine whether medicines were stored under proper conditions and whether they preserved their efficacy and safety until reaching customers.

From faulty mines to grenade launchers 1980-kh: how «Ukrainian Armored Vehicle» earns billions on defense contracts
For four years Ukrainian troops have fought not only the Russian army but also with faulty and malfunctioning weapons purchased with billions of hryvnias of budget funds. One of the largest suppliers remains LLC «Ukrainian Armored Vehicle», which NBU and SAP called the actual asset of Serhiy Pashinsky. Despite loud scandals, criminal proceedings and allegations about product quality, the company continues to receive multi-billion state contracts. Pashinsky himself publicly defends the company, although he is not officially its owner.
A further example is the contract for 637 million UAH, which in February 2026 year the Defense Procurement Agency under Arsen Zhumasdalov concluded with «Ukrainian Armored Vehicle» for supply of 6 thousand RPG-75M grenade launchers. Despite warnings from the Logistics Forces Command of the Ukrainian Armed Forces about the low effectiveness of this weapon, the company received an advance of 318,5 million UAH even before acceptance. The first batch of 3024 grenade launchers was refused by the military, and during investigative actions brand new labels revealed factory markings in Czech. After dismantling them it turned out some components were manufactured as early as 1986–1988 years.
No less revealing is the story with the supply of 120-mm mortar rounds through the Romanian company Carfil. Tens of thousands of ammunition had to be returned due to manufacturing defects, and among violations were the use of explosive substances with critically expired storage. Nevertheless, in 2024 year «Ukrainian Armored Vehicle» received defense orders worth over 36 billion UAH, with over 134 million UAH in debt to the state. At the same time, in various contracts there were reports of possible multi-million overpayments, inflated prices and advance payments without necessary export licenses.
In 2026 year, it was «Ukrainian Armored Vehicle» that tried to secure for itself the status of the virtually sole supplier of 155-mm artillery projectiles for the state.
